When comparing the sulfur chemistry within the *Allium* genus, research concerning garlic indicates that its specific compound, s-allyl cysteine, possesses the capability to directly stimulate both testosterone production and sperm count. This contrasts slightly with the research focus on onions, which emphasizes quercetin's antioxidant role and the general benefit of sulfur compounds like S-methyl cysteine sulfoxide. The differentiation between specific sulfur compounds across relatives like garlic and onion highlights that slight variations in chemical structure within the genus can lead to differential documented primary effects on hormonal and sperm parameters, although both share a broader, sulfur-derived benefit.
